配置的機制:在登陸方生成金鑰對,然後將公鑰複製給目標主機,在目標主機上將這個公鑰加入授權檔案 ~/.ssh/authorized_keys (該檔案的許可權: 600)
1)在登入方生成金鑰對,執行指令碼命令
ssh-keygen
2)複製給目標主機,執行指令碼命令
ssh-copy-id node2
ssh-copy-id node3
此時就可以免密登入 node1,node2,node3了
3)驗證
[root@node1 ~]# ssh node3
last
login:
fridec
8 09:55:
462017 from 192.168.1.109
[root@node3 ~]#
在node1免密登入node3 Mac ,Linux 之間ssh 金鑰登陸
1 被登陸機器使用者家目錄下 ssh 目錄下新建 authorized keys 檔案用於存放允許登陸機器的公鑰 2 修改被登陸機器的 etc ssh sshd config 檔案 rsaauthentication yes pubkeyauthentication yes authorizedke...
ssh登陸認證過程詳解
版本號協商階段 金鑰和演算法協商階段 認證階段 會話請求階段 會話互動階段 1.版本號協商階段 2.金鑰和演算法協商階段服務端和客戶端分別傳送演算法協商報文給對方,報文中包含自己支援的公鑰演算法列表 加密演算法列表 訊息驗證碼演算法列表 壓縮演算法列表等。服務端和客戶端根據對方和自己支援的演算法得出...
SSH金鑰登陸免密碼方法
linux金鑰免密碼登陸方法 如下 在a機器上輸入命令 ssh agent 然後回車 執行後,出現三行,類似於 ssh auth sock tmp ssh mvigzr1522 agent.1522 export ssh auth sock ssh agent pid 1523 export ssh...